Loyalist mural, Kilburn St., The Village, South Belfast, 2008. Mural dedicated to Ulster Freedom Fighters, cover name for UDA. UFF insignia and two paramilitary figures.

Loyalist mural and memorial , City Way, Sandy Row, South Belfast, 2008. Mural commemorates the dead of the two World Wars; memorial features iinsignia of South Belfast Brigade UDA, UYM, UFF, LPA.

Republican mural, Lecky Rd., Derry. Hunger Strike mural with portraits of the Ten Hunger Strikers framed by two Republican volunteers firing last salute.

Loyalist mural, Lord St., East Belfast, 2002, 'UDA 2nd Batt. UYM. UFF'; UDA crest flanked by two paramilitary figures.
